Gravel pad installation services involve preparing a stable, level foundation made primarily of compacted gravel to support various structures or equipment. This process typically includes clearing the designated area, grading the surface to ensure proper drainage, and then spreading and compacting gravel to create a durable base. The result is a solid platform that provides stability, reduces uneven settling, and helps prevent shifting or sinking over time. These services are essential for establishing a reliable foundation for structures such as sheds, decks, HVAC units, or outdoor machinery.
One of the primary benefits of gravel pad installation is its ability to address issues related to ground instability and poor drainage. Without a proper foundation, structures may become uneven or suffer damage due to shifting soil or excess moisture. Gravel pads help mitigate these problems by creating a permeable base that allows water to drain away efficiently, reducing the risk of water pooling or erosion beneath the structure. This can extend the lifespan of the installed equipment or building components, minimizing maintenance needs and potential repair costs.

Material Costs - The cost for gravel material typically ranges from $1 to $3 per square foot, depending on the type and quality of gravel selected. For a standard 10x10 foot pad, material expenses may be between $100 and $300.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or fees gener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. For a typical gravel pad, labor costs can total around $200 to $500, depending on site conditions and project complexity.
Equipment and Preparation - Additional costs for site preparation, such as leveling and compacting, may add $100 to $300. Equipment rental fees, if necessary, are often included in the overall installation estimate.
Total Cost Range - Overall, gravel pad installation services in Lexington Park, MD, usually range from $300 to $1,000. Costs vary based on size, materials, and site-specific requ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a gravel pad installation? Gravel pad installation involves preparing a level base of gravel to support structures like sheds, decks, or walkways, providing stability and drainage.
How long does a gravel pad installation typ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and scope of the project, but most installations can be completed within a day or two by local contractors.
What factors should be considered when installing a gravel pad? Important factors include the location, drainage needs, size requirements, and the type of gravel used for optimal stability.
Are there different types of gravel suitable for a pad? Yes, common options include crushed stone, decomposed granite, and washed gravel, each offering different levels of compaction and drainage.
